Overview of the Framework Laptop 16
The Framework Laptop 16 is a modular, customizable device designed to prioritize repairability and longevity. Its open design allows users to replace or upgrade components easily, reducing electronic waste and extending the device’s lifespan.
Security Features of the Framework Laptop 16
The laptop incorporates several security features aimed at protecting user data and preventing unauthorized access. These include:
- TPM 2.0 Chip: Provides hardware-based security functions, including secure boot and encryption key storage.
- Secure Boot: Ensures that only trusted software loads during startup, preventing malware from infecting the system at boot time.
- Hardware Kill Switches: Allows users to physically disable the camera and microphone, enhancing privacy.
- BIOS Security: Password protection and firmware integrity checks prevent unauthorized BIOS modifications.

Open-Source Firmware and Transparency
The use of open-source firmware allows users and security researchers to review the code, identify vulnerabilities, and ensure that no malicious features are embedded. This transparency is a significant advantage over closed systems.
